1. Ease of Maintenance One of the primary benefits of ceiling access panels is that they significantly ease the process of maintenance. Regular servicing of electrical systems, plumbing, and HVAC units is essential to ensure optimal functioning and to prevent costly breakdowns. By providing ready access, these panels reduce the time and effort required to perform maintenance tasks.

With the hanger wires in place, it’s time to install the main runners. Start one end of the main runner into the wall angle, then adjust the other end to hang from the hanger wires. Use a level to ensure the runner is straight, making any adjustments as necessary. Secure the runner to the hanger wires with wire ties or clamps.


Suspended ceiling grids, also known as drop ceilings or false ceilings, are popular installations in both residential and commercial spaces. They serve both functional and aesthetic purposes, offering insulation, soundproofing, and a polished look to any interior environment.
